How AI Resume Parsing Actually Works
Let's demystify the technology. AI resume parsing uses Natural Language Processing (NLP) to understand resumes the way humans do – but 1,000x faster.
Step 1: Document Extraction
The AI extracts text from any format – PDF, Word, even images. It handles:
- Multi-column layouts
- Tables and graphics
- 100+ languages
- Handwritten notes (yes, really)
Step 2: Entity Recognition
The AI identifies and categorizes information:
Personal Information
- • Name and contact details
- • Location and willingness to relocate
- • Work authorization status
Professional Background
- • Job titles and companies
- • Employment dates and gaps
- • Responsibilities and achievements
Skills & Qualifications
- • Technical skills and tools
- • Soft skills and competencies
- • Certifications and licenses
Education & Training
- • Degrees and institutions
- • Relevant coursework
- • Professional development
Step 3: Semantic Understanding
This is where AI crushes traditional ATS. It understands that:
- "Software Developer" = "Software Engineer" = "Programmer"
- "Managed team of 5" = Leadership experience
- "Increased sales by 50%" = Quantifiable achievement
- "Python, Django, PostgreSQL" = Full-stack capability

Setting Up AI Screening: The Practical Guide
Step 1: Define Your Ideal Candidate Profile
AI is only as good as your instructions. Be specific:
Example: Senior Backend Engineer
Must-Haves (Knockouts)
- • 5+ years backend development
- • Python or Java expertise
- • Distributed systems experience
- • BS in CS or equivalent
Nice-to-Haves (Bonus Points)
- • AWS/Cloud experience
- • Team lead experience
- • Open source contributions
- • Startup background
Step 2: Train the AI on Your Preferences
Most AI systems learn from your feedback:
- Review first 20-30 AI recommendations
- Mark which ones you'd interview
- AI adjusts its scoring model
- Accuracy improves from ~75% to 94% after 50 reviews
Step 3: Set Up Your Workflow
Optimal AI Screening Workflow
- Applicants apply → Resumes go to AI
- AI screens in 0.2 seconds → Scores 0-100%
- Top 20% auto-advance → Get screening questions
- Middle 30% flagged for review → Human decides
- Bottom 50% auto-rejected → Get polite decline
- Weekly AI retraining → Based on hire outcomes
Common Misconceptions About AI Screening
Myth: "AI is biased against certain groups"
Reality: AI can be programmed to ignore names, ages, photos, and other bias-inducing information. Studies show AI screening increases diversity by 38% compared to human screening.
Myth: "AI can't understand context or nuance"
Reality: Modern AI understands career transitions, gaps in employment, and transferable skills better than keyword-matching systems. It knows a "Product Manager at startup" might equal "VP Product at corporation."
Myth: "AI will replace recruiters"
Reality: AI handles the tedious screening. Recruiters focus on relationship building, culture assessment, and closing candidates – the high-value human work.
